"Geology," "Earth science" and "geoscience" are different terms with the same literal definition: the study of the Earth. In the academic world and the professional realm, the terms may be interchangeable or have different connotations based on how they are being used. Simultaneous waveform inversion of seismic-while-drilling data for P-wave velocity, density, and source …Natural glass occurs on Earth in different geological contexts, mainly as volcanic glass, fulgurites, and impact glass. All these different types of glasses are predominantly composed of silica with variable amounts of impurities, especially the alkalis, and differ in their water content due to their mode of formation.

This water-filled sinkhole is the deepest known cave in the Bahamas, and the second deepest in the world, at 202 m. Geoscience (also called Earth Science) is the study of Earth. Geoscience includes so much more than rocks and volcanoes, it studies the processes that form and shape Earth's surface, the natural resources we use, and how water and ecosystems are interconnected. About GSL. The Geological Society of London is the UK national society for geoscience, providing support to over 12,000 members in the UK and overseas.
